I used a flat tip screwdriver (to be placed from the underside to push the retaining clip upwards, a pair of pliers to hold pressure on the clip, a small mallet to hit the mount upwards, and a large bucket of swearing.
It took about 10 mins to remove the mirror for my TJ Advance, and FA time to install the new one on.
